Overview:

A Senior Partnerships Manager is responsible for developing and managing relationships with external partners to create mutually beneficial business opportunities. They are responsible for identifying potential partners, negotiating contracts, and managing the relationship to ensure that both parties are satisfied with the results. They must have excellent communication and negotiation skills, as well as a thorough understanding of the industry and the company’s goals.

How To Become an Senior Partnerships Manager:

To become a Senior Partnerships Manager, you will need to have a bachelor’s degree in business, marketing, or a related field. You should also have experience in sales, marketing, or customer service. Additionally, you should have strong communication and negotiation skills, as well as an understanding of the industry and the company’s goals.

What tools help Senior Partnerships Manager work better?
• CRM software: CRM software helps Senior Partnerships Managers track customer relationships, manage contacts, and analyze customer data.
• Project management software: Project management software helps Senior Partnerships Managers manage projects, track progress, and collaborate with team members.
• Business intelligence software: Business intelligence software helps Senior Partnerships Managers analyze data, identify trends, and make informed decisions.
• Social media management software: Social media management software helps Senior Partnerships Managers manage social media accounts, track engagement, and measure the success of campaigns.
Good tips to help Senior Partnerships Manager do more effectively?
• Develop strong relationships with partners: Building strong relationships with partners is essential for success as a Senior Partnerships Manager. Make sure to stay in touch with partners regularly and be proactive in finding ways to help them succeed.
• Stay up to date on industry trends: Staying up to date on industry trends is important for a Senior Partnerships Manager. Make sure to read industry publications and attend relevant conferences to stay informed.
• Utilize data to make decisions: Utilizing data to make decisions is essential for a Senior Partnerships Manager. Make sure to analyze customer data and market trends to make informed decisions.
• Develop creative solutions: Developing creative solutions is important for a Senior Partnerships Manager. Make sure to think outside the box and come up with innovative solutions to problems.
